- What is Zions Bancorporation's current debt?
- Zions Bancorporation (ZION) reported current debt of $3.1B in Q4 2025.
- How has Zions Bancorporation's current debt changed year-over-year?
- Zions Bancorporation's current debt decreased by 19.0% year-over-year, from $3.83B to $3.1B.
- What is the long-term trend for Zions Bancorporation's current debt?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Zions Bancorporation's current debt has grown at a 14.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$1.57B to $3.1B.
